AMP Robotics is a pioneer and industry leader in artificial intelligence (AI), robotics, and infrastructure for the waste and recycling industry. We’re working to reimagine and actively modernize recycling by applying AI and automation to increase recycling rates and economically recover recyclables reclaimed as raw materials for the global supply chain. We build and deploy cutting-edge technology solutions that solve many of the central challenges of recycling to make it more efficient, cost-effective, scalable, and sustainable. 

Headquartered in Louisville, Colorado, the Denver Post named AMP one of the 2021 Top Workplaces in Colorado. AMP Robotics is seeking a driven and proactive Senior Engineering Program Manager (EPM) to join its growing team in Louisville, Colorado. The ideal candidate will have technical program management experience across multiple engineering disciplines, especially software and machine learning, as well as exposure to the cross-functional departments with whom you will partner to realize a new product, including product management, sales, manufacturing, operations, supply chain, and quality teams.

As an EPM at AMP Robotics, you will have the opportunity to:

  • Lead one or more multi-disciplinary engineering project teams developing new technologies, software, and machine learning capabilities  in pursuit of AMP’s vision for a world without waste
  • Develop, manage, and communicate project schedules, budgets, goals, and deliverables to the project teams and cross-functional stakeholders
  • Partner with Product Management to triage new feature requests and allocate available engineering resources efficiently. 
  • Execute project plans while closely monitoring performance metrics
  • Collaborate with the Engineering leadership team to troubleshoot project issues, assess allocation of resources, and continually mitigate risk as projects unfold
  • Exercise swift and sound judgement to make critical project changes as required, while assessing risks and controlling scope
  • Host and drive a variety of meetings, including internal engineering team meetings, interdepartmental program alignment meetings, phase gate review, and external vendor discussions
  • Motivate and empower your team to meet stated goals and deliverables on schedule, while recognizing and rewarding success on the team
  • Accelerate the pace of product development and new product introductions by leveraging and implementing project management best practices

The successful candidate will have:

Required:

  • 6+ years of demonstrated success leading cross-functional engineering programs in a Technical or Engineering Program/Project Management role in which you were responsible for the program budget, schedule, and scope
  • Experience leading projects in which artificial intelligence/machine learning and computer vision were core technologies
  • Experience synthesizing project inputs from wide range of engineering disciplines: Software, Machine Learning, Electrical, Firmware/Embedded Systems, and Robotics are preferred
  • A track-record of launching  4+ products or sub-systems as a lead project manager from concept to completion by leveraging project management best practices, methodologies, and tools
  • Exemplary written communication and public speaking skills, which you exercise to lead team meetings and engage with stakeholders at all levels of the company
  • The ability to independently and diplomatically solve complex challenges with a positive attitude, as well as sound judgement of when to escalate issues to leadership
  • Deep knowledge of product development principles gained through professional experience, including a comprehensive understanding of the product development processes for different engineering disciplines and how they interact

Preferred: 

  • A degree in a relevant engineering field, or related degree/work experience
  • Extensive experience successfully planning scope, schedule and budgets for multiple large-scale projects and executing within those parameters
  • Proficiency in authoring technical requirements documents
  • Experience managing and analyzing large datasets in excel or google sheets, as well as an ability to distill quantifiable and subjective data points from many stakeholders into succinct decision matrices
  • A knack for gracefully managing shifting priorities and a comfort with delegation in order to leverage your finite bandwidth
  • Proficiency with Jira, Confluence, and Smartsheets as project management tools.

Salary & Compensation Information: $116,000 - $161,000 depending on experience.

Benefits Information:

  • Medical - The company covers up 85% to 100% of the premium for Cigna healthcare plans depending on the selection. Employees pay the difference in premium if they select a more expensive plan. Up to 75% for dependents. 
  • Dental, Vision, Short and Long Term Disability.
  • 401(k) retirement plan (non-matching).
  • 14 days PTO and 6 paid sick days.
  • Nine (9) paid holidays – 7 company designated and 2 floating holidays. (salaried employees only).
